The City of Stamford Curbside Pick Up

The City of Stamford says Christmas Tree pickup is anticipated to begin in late January. More details will be provided soon.

Christmas Tree Pick up Guidelines

  • Trees placed curbside cannot have any decorations on them
  • Trees cannot be placed in plastic bags or wrapped in plastic
  • No brush, grass clippings or bulky waste will be picked up
  • Plastic Christmas trees will not be picked up

Drop Off at the Recycling Center

You can immediately take your tree to either the Katrina Mygatt Recycling Center located at 130 Magee Avenue or the Scale House located at 101 Harborview Avenue.

Ecocycle Your Christmas Tree

Trees can be dropped off at Mianus River Park, Stamford from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. on Saturdays, January 9 and 16. A $10 suggested donation is recommended.

Your tree will join hundreds of others being used to help stabilize streambanks, reduce erosion and create refuge habitat for wildlife. Each summer, volunteers with the Mianus Chapter of Trout Unlimited anchor these pine trees in the river, creating a structure called a “conifer revetment” which helps trap silt in the river, rebuilds eroded banks and develops a narrower, deeper and cooler river that is better for the fish and wildlife living along the river.
